1、定义未赋值undefined

2、typeof未定义的或未赋值的变量(引用未定义的变量将导致ReferenceError)

3、null严格的来说是一个空的对象节点,typeof null is a object

4、undefined是一个派生的null

5、null的存在:当一个object是被希望的但是还没有属性或方法的时候,null就代替了它的位置

6、如果你想知道值到底是null还是undefined,可以用String()方法

转载于:https://www.cnblogs.com/miaozi1123/archive/2010/09/03/javascript_datatypes.html

js undefined null相关推荐

  1. js 中null,undefined区别

    首先摘自阮一峰先生的文章: 大多数计算机语言,有且仅有一个表示"无"的值,比如,C语言的NULL,Java语言的null,Python语言的None,Ruby语言的nil. 有点奇 ...

  2. js 判断 ““,null,undefined

    js 判断 "",null,undefined if (mid == "" || mid == null || mid == undefined) { // & ...

  3. 布尔型Boolean+undefined+null(JS)

    布尔型Boolean+undefined+null(JS) <!DOCTYPE html> <html lang="en"><head>< ...

  4. js中null,undefined,false,0,'',[],{}判断方法

    目录 1.数据类型 2.JSON字符串 3.数字类型 4.非的布尔值 5.与非比较 一.单独判断 1.null 2.undefined 3.0 4."" 5.判断undefined ...

  5. js中null和undefined区别

    null是空对象引用,引用指向为空 undefined是只定义了引用 typeof null:"object" typeof undefined : "undefined ...

  6. JS undefined报错

    JS undefined报错 查看:onclick的调用者未找到 原因:调用该方法的变量的值为null,即节点未找到 解决:在引用此变量的前文对此变量进行定义并赋值,不可以在后面定义并赋值,js是从上 ...

  7. 2022-JavaScript-过滤数组中的undefined,null,空串,NaN

    2022-JavaScript-过滤数组中的undefined,null,空串,NaN let arr = [1,'',2,null,3,NaN,4,unfined,5,'',6] let arr1 ...

  8. js中null和undefined的区别

    在JavaScript开发中,被人问到:null与undefined到底有啥区别? 一时间不好回答,特别是undefined,因为这涉及到undefined的实现原理. 总所周知:null == un ...

  9. [JS] undefined、null、ReferenceError的区别、变量作用域问题

    undefined.null.ReferenceError的区别 null表示"没有对象",即该处不应该有值. 典型用法是: (1) 作为函数的参数,表示该函数的参数不是对象. ( ...

  10. JavaScript技术篇 - js的null值判断,js的undefined的判断,js的null与undefined的2种区分方法

    undefined 和 null 用 == 比较是相等的,我们可以有两种方法来进行区分. 区别方法一: 因为他们的类型时不同的,=== 会先比较类型,再比较值,所有可以直接用 === 来进行区分. n ...

最新文章

  1. 【云栖直播】精彩推荐第2期:首届阿里巴巴研发效能嘉年华
  2. solr5.5在centos7上的安装
  3. java 左边补0_java基础知识
  4. activiti入门2流程引擎API和服务基础设施
  5. cannot find any entry in order attachment link
  6. 利用Vulnhub复现漏洞 - JBoss JMXInvokerServlet 反序列化漏洞
  7. myeclipse上进行tomcat远程调试
  8. JAVA入门级教学之(算数运算符)
  9. 小度智能音箱维修点_小度智能音箱无法唤醒怎么办
  10. C# 使用 MemoryStream 将数据写入内存
  11. AcWing 896. 最长上升子序列 II(二分优化LIS)
  12. ADB 安装 + 打驱动全教程
  13. 机器视觉最常见的五大典型应用
  14. 安卓短信转发qq邮箱
  15. 【前端大屏可视化项目适配方案】
  16. 华为手机桌面角标开发
  17. Python为何能上位碾压Java?
  18. java opencv 阀值分割_opencv-阈值分割
  19. 服装行业如何用手持PDA盘点?
  20. 美国加州中学课本 教材介绍 - Glencoe系列- 美国初中语文 数学 科学 健康

热门文章

  1. 使用卡方分箱进行数据离散化-python实现
  2. vue样式初始化_Vue 中的样式绑定
  3. matlab中单位格式,[转载]matlab中的数据显示格式-format
  4. 翻译: 2.5. 自动微分 深入神经网络 pytorch
  5. 极客大学架构师训练营 毕业典礼 奉献优秀架构师升级攻略
  6. Xcode证书错误 Provisioning profile does not support the Associated Domains capability
  7. Sublime 3 打开GBK 编码文件中文乱码 解决办法
  8. bootstrap交互式网页设计工具_3款强大的BootStrap的可视化制作工具推荐
  9. TypeError: 'list' object is not callable
  10. 特征选择---文本分类:叉方统计量 卡方